When dragging a point with the direct select tool, I can snap the point to other points EXCEPT FOR points directly next to my selected point on the path.

  • June 17, 2026
  • 2 replies
  • 30 views

I used to be able to drag a point with the direct select tool and snap it to other points directly next to my selected point on the path it lives on. After recent updates, I can only snap my selected point to other points not directly next to my selected point. 

This isn’t a snap to grid issue or tolerance issue. Snapping works fine when dragging my point to any point that’s not directly next to my selected point.

Additionally, other snapping that used to work fine now does not work at all. For example, snapping a point to a line… Something about the recent updates have jacked up snapping.
